Output 62a752e6606178b18f1e6da130ccf6c747f34787f29a056192095bf4f97a9d8a:24

value
1923216
script pubkey
OP_0 OP_PUSHBYTES_20 bb7ea66209bddf4f1ff6eda4d99ea0a5f5a186a7
address
bc1qhdl2vcsfhh0578lkakjdn84q5h66rp4807m5dk
transaction
62a752e6606178b18f1e6da130ccf6c747f34787f29a056192095bf4f97a9d8a
spent
true